在Raspberry Pi上安装和配置V2Ray的详细指南

引言

在现代互联网环境中,网络隐私安全性变得愈发重要。V2Ray作为一种功能强大的代理工具,能够有效保护用户的上网隐私和提高网络访问速度。本文将为您提供在Raspberry Pi上安装和配置V2Ray的详细步骤,并解答常见问题。

Raspberry Pi简介

Raspberry Pi是一款功能强大的单板计算机,其小巧的体积和出色的性价比,使其成为了许多项目的首选。无论是作为家庭媒体中心,还是用作网络代理服务器,Raspberry Pi都能够发挥巨大的作用。

为什么选择V2Ray?

V2Ray是一个强大的网络代理工具,它相比于传统的代理工具具备以下优势:

  • 多协议支持:支持多种协议,包括VMess、Shadowsocks等。
  • 灵活配置:提供丰富的配置选项,适应不同的网络环境。
  • 强大的安全性:通过加密技术保护用户隐私。

环境准备

在开始安装V2Ray之前,您需要准备以下环境:

  1. 一台Raspberry Pi:建议使用Raspberry Pi 3或更高版本。
  2. 操作系统:推荐使用Raspbian,确保系统更新到最新版本。
  3. 网络连接:确保Raspberry Pi可以访问互联网。

安装V2Ray的步骤

1. 更新系统

首先,您需要更新Raspberry Pi的系统包,以确保所有软件都是最新的。可以使用以下命令: bash sudo apt-get update && sudo apt-get upgrade

2. 安装依赖

V2Ray需要一些基本依赖项,您可以使用以下命令进行安装: bash sudo apt-get install -y wget unzip

3. 下载V2Ray

使用wget命令下载V2Ray的最新版本: bash wget https://github.com/v2ray/v2ray-core/releases/latest/download/v2ray-linux-arm64.zip

4. 解压文件

使用unzip命令解压下载的文件: bash unzip v2ray-linux-arm64.zip

5. 移动文件

将解压后的文件移动到系统路径中: bash sudo mv v2ray v2ctl /usr/local/bin/

6. 创建配置文件

V2Ray需要配置文件来运行。您可以在/etc/v2ray/目录下创建一个配置文件: bash sudo mkdir /etc/v2ray sudo nano /etc/v2ray/config.json

在配置文件中,您需要根据您的需求填写相应的配置内容。

7. 启动V2Ray

您可以使用以下命令启动V2Ray: bash sudo systemctl start v2ray

并设置为开机自启: bash sudo systemctl enable v2ray

常见配置选项

在配置V2Ray时,您可能会遇到以下选项:

  • port:设置V2Ray的监听端口。
  • protocol:选择使用的协议类型。
  • security:选择加密方式。

V2Ray的优化建议

在使用V2Ray时,您可以考虑以下优化建议:

  • 选择合适的服务器:选择距离较近的服务器以提高速度。
  • 调整MTU:根据您的网络情况调整最大传输单元。
  • 使用CDN:为您的服务增加CDN以提高稳定性。

常见问题解答(FAQ)

Q1: 如何检查V2Ray是否成功安装?

A1: 您可以通过运行v2ray -version命令来检查V2Ray的版本信息。如果显示版本号,说明安装成功。

Q2: V2Ray的配置文件在哪里?

A2: V2Ray的配置文件通常位于/etc/v2ray/config.json,您可以使用文本编辑器打开并进行编辑。

Q3: 如何查看V2Ray的运行日志?

A3: 您可以使用命令sudo journalctl -u v2ray查看V2Ray的运行日志,便于排查问题。

Q4: 如何安全关闭V2Ray?

A4: 您可以使用以下命令安全关闭V2Ray: bash sudo systemctl stop v2ray

Q5: 如何更新V2Ray到最新版本?

A5: 您可以重新下载最新版本的V2Ray,然后按照安装步骤进行更新。

总结

通过以上步骤,您应该能够在Raspberry Pi上成功安装和配置V2Ray,享受更加安全和快速的网络体验。如果在使用过程中遇到问题,可以参考本文的FAQ部分,或者查阅更多的网络资源。希望您在使用V2Ray的过程中,能够获得满意的体验。

正文完